Aaron Rodgers made it clear: It’s on the Packers now.
Rodgers said Wednesday on “The Pat McAfee Show” it has been his intention to play for the Jets since Friday, but the Packers are holding a trade up.
“I haven’t been holding anything up. At this point it’s been compensation that the Packers are trying to get for me, kind of digging their heels in. It is interesting at this point to step back and take a look at the whole picture,” Rodgers said.
So, what do the Packers want?
Before the 39-year-old quarterback’s McAfee appearance, there were conflicting reports about Green Bay’s compensation requests.
On Wednesday’s installment of the ESPN morning show “Get Up,” the network’s NFL insider Adam Schefter said the Packers want two first-round picks for Rodgers — similar to what the Rams gave up to acquire Matthew Stafford from the Lions in January 2021.
